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Mersa Matruh to Athens is to bus and fly which costs €95 - €220 and takes 10h 58m.
The fastest way to get from Mersa Matruh to Athens is to fly which takes 8h 36m and costs €230 - €950.
The distance between Mersa Matruh and Athens is 1299 km.
It takes approximately 13h 30m to get from Mersa Matruh to Athens, including transfers.
